Indian police, while being on high alert, report that they have arrested a small armed Islamic group. This group has confessed that they intended to carry out a large-scale attack in Delhi, a city that will be hosting the 'Republic Day' celebrations on Monday. Indian officials say that early on Sunday, three members of the armed Islamic group known as 'Lashkar-e-Taiba' were arrested. The group's cache of weapons and explosives has also been discovered. In recent years, the 'Republic Day' celebrations, which have marked the beginning of the republic in India since 1950, have consistently been targeted by armed groups from Kashmir. In another incident, India also reports that its military forces have seized over 100 grenades and other explosive materials from several armed suspects who were hiding in Kashmir. Thousands of other small arms and military ammunition have also been discovered and confiscated.
